Reproduction in beings of class Reptilia
Explain the procedure of reproduction in the beings of class Reptilia?
Expert
Beings of the class Reptilia reproduce sexually by the internal fecundation by the process of the copulation between male and female individuals. They lay eggs surrounded with the shell and the extraembryonic membranes. The embryo therefore develops within the egg and outside the body of the mother; on the other hand, ovoviviparous reptiles retain the egg within the body until hatching.
